While I still have to file the paperwork, we now have approval from the Jekyll Island Authority for Monday May 14th to Friday May 18.
This is a bit later in May than some previous years, but we are slaves to Newtonian physics, planetary mechanics and the fuzzy science of weather
prediction. Here are the predicted (low) tide times and levels for that week...
Monday May 14 2:23 pm -0.5
Tuesday May 15 3:11 p -0.7
Wednesday May 16 3:59 -0.8
Thursday May 17 4:48 p -0.7
Friday May 18 5:40 p -0.5
With negative tides (lower than mean), it looks like big beaches all week.
